If you want to be a good leader, be honest. A leader will always try to lead with righteousness. When you remain honest, people will notice and appreciate you. Your honesty will influence your followers to be honest as well.

When you’re a good leader, you should quickly see the talent potential in other people. Make sure your crew is diverse and offers many qualities. This is important when needing to hire or contract for small jobs.

Be clear with possible issues whenever you can. Good leaders don’t want to hide problems with their business. What is the reason for this? It’s a very communicative world these days. Problems will be noticed no matter if you try to hide them. So be the person that controls the message. Don’t be the one reacting to it. Great leaders stay on that path.

Being ethical is crucial to being a good leader. Every sound business must be ethical. When people know you are thinking about their best interests, they will be loyal. Developing moral responsibilities for the employees, you can be sure rules are followed.

If you want to be trusted as a legitimate leader, never act like a know-it-all. You may think your ideas are the best, but it is important to listen to what others have to say. They can suggest things to you about how your idea can be improved, executed better, or what the problems in the plan are.
